Spring Yard Cleanup in Ventura County, CA
Spring yard cleanup services involve clearing away winter debris and preparing outdoor spaces for the warmer months. This typically includes removing fallen leaves, branches, and other organic matter, as well as trimming overgrown bushes and shrubs. Property owners often request these services to enhance curb appeal, promote healthy plant growth, and create a tidy, inviting outdoor environment for family gatherings, outdoor activities, or simply enjoying the season.
Before requesting spring yard cleanup, homeowners usually want to understand the scope of work involved, including which areas will be addressed and what types of debris will be removed. It’s also helpful to clarify if additional services such as lawn edging, pruning, or planting are included or available. Knowing the details of the cleanup process can ensure the project aligns with specific property needs and expectations for a well-maintained yard throughout the season.

Common Spring Yard Cleanup Jobs
Yard debris removal - clearing fallen leaves, branches, and clutter from lawns and gardens.
Spring pruning services - trimming shrubs and trees to promote healthy growth and enhance curb appeal.
Garden bed cleanup - removing weeds, dead plants, and debris to prepare flower beds for planting.
Lawn edging and trimming - defining lawn boundaries and tidying up overgrown grass along walkways and borders.
Storm damage cleanup - clearing debris caused by wind or rain to restore yard safety and appearance.
Leaf and pine needle removal - raking and collecting seasonal foliage to maintain a tidy outdoor space.
Spring Yard Cleanup Questions
What is included in spring yard cleanup services? These services typically involve removing debris, trimming overgrown plants, clearing gutters, and preparing the landscape for the season.
When is the best time for spring yard cleanup? The ideal time is early spring, once winter debris has settled and before active growth begins.
Can yard cleanup services help with overgrown bushes and shrubs? Yes, trimming and shaping overgrown bushes and shrubs is often part of the cleanup process.
